    I've got a xd file from a design agency with a newsletter design.
    After exporting a part of the design as png, I picked up the hex color value from the EXACT same part.
    After joining both together in a newsletter template I have to build, I recognise different colors of the exported graphic and the hex color I used as background color for some parts.
    By using the color picker from the inspection tool of my browser, I found out, that the color of the exported graphic was different from the hex color!
    After this, I opened the graphic with photoshop and used the colorpicker from there and I got the hex code value from xd!
    After "exporting as ..." the graphic using photoshop and checking the "convert to sRGB" in the export dialog, I got a graphic with the correct matching color.
